Does the Cleaver house still exist?

This house currently features as ‘4352 Wisteria Lane’ on Desperate Housewives, and was originally built for the 1996 ‘Leave It To Beaver’ movie. It’s been on Colonial Street ever since.

Is the burbs set the same as Desperate Housewives?

Though The ‘Burbs is a memorable milestone in the history of Colonial Street, no other production has used the location as much as the Earth-shatteringly popular ABC series, Desperate Housewives (2004-2012), which famously transformed the outdoor set into Wisteria Lane.

Was Desperate Housewives filmed in Universal Studios?

Desperate Housewives was mainly shot at Universal Studios, 100 Universal City Plaza, Universal City, California, USA. Filming also took place in Toluca Lake, Los Angeles.

Was the house on Father Knows Best a real house?

You can spot the Anderson house in other classic sitcoms.
Originally built on the Columbia Pictures backlot in 1941 for the film Blondie, a cinematic adaptation of the popular daily comic strip, the Anderson house was recycled again and again over the years. It was Mr. Wilson’s home in the Dennis the Menace TV series.

Why did Father Knows Best get Cancelled?

However, “Father Knows Best” would be abruptly canceled. The magazine added part of the reason was due to a strike of the Writers Guild of America lasted from January to June 1960. “Miss Messenger called me and said, ‘You’re not going back anymore,’” she recalled.

Why did June Cleaver always wear pearls?

June Cleaver wore pearls to make filming easier
Reportedly, Billingsley was asked to wear pearls because she had a deep hollow in her neck. The spot was difficult to film around and cast a strange shadow. The pearls covered the area perfectly.

Did the Cleavers move to a new house?

The family was forced to move.
In the middle of the series, the Cleavers move from 485 Mapleton Drive to 211 Pine Street. There was a production reason for the relo. The facade of the original home was located on the Republic Studios lot, and the show switched its production to Universal.

How did Theodore get the name beaver?

It was not until the finale that the writers invented an explanation for the nickname; i.e., as a young child, Wally mispronounced Beaver’s given name (Theodore) as “Tweeter” and this became “Beaver.” Mathers opined that after 6 years and 234 episodes, the writers could have come up with a better origin story.

Is Chilton based on a real school?

Chilton is actually based on a real Connecticut prep school named Choate Rosemary Hall in Wallingford and it’s one of the leading private boarding schools in the U.S. Choate boasts an impressive list alums, including President John F. Kennedy, playwright Edward Albee, and actress Glenn Close.

What town is Stars Hollow based on?

Though fictitious, Stars Hollow was inspired by quaint, quirky hamlets across New England. Show creator Amy Sherman-Palladino has revealed that the town Washington Depot, CT, first inspired Stars Hollow for her.
